Garyfalia Charitaki; Isidora Kourti; Jess L. Gregory; Mesut Ozturk; Zaleha Ismail; Anastasia Alevriadou; Spyridon-Georgios Soulis; Maria Kypriotaki; Sehnaz Sakici; Can Demirel – Educational Research and Evaluation, 2025
This study aims to explore differences across Greece, the UK, the USA, Malaysia, Romania, and Turkey in terms of their attitudes towards inclusive education and validate the three-model structure for attitudes towards inclusion across the above six countries. Giavrimis Panagiotis – Journal of Research in Special Educational Needs, 2024
Inclusion classes (IC) are one of Greece's most crucial educational inclusion policies. This paper explores the institution of inclusion classes as a supportive educational framework for students with special educational needs and/or disabilities (SEND) for their inclusion in the mainstream education system through teachers' conceptualisations. Maro Doikou – International Journal of Emotional Education, 2024
Pupils with special educational needs and disabilities (SEND) are at risk for emotional, behavioural and social difficulties. Social and emotional learning (SEL) may be particularly beneficial to fostering these children's resilience.
